Starlink is a satellite constellation developed by SpaceX, a private aerospace manufacturer and space transport services company founded by Elon Musk. The project aims to provide high-speed, low-latency internet connectivity across the globe, especially in areas where traditional internet infrastructure is limited or non-existent. With its advanced technology and ambitious goals, Starlink is poised to revolutionize the way we access and use the internet.
History and Development of Starlink
The concept of Starlink was first announced by Elon Musk in 2015, with the goal of creating a constellation of satellites that could provide internet access to the entire world. Since then, SpaceX has been working tirelessly to develop and launch the necessary satellites, with the first batch of 60 satellites launched in May 2019. As of now, there are over 2,000 satellites in orbit, with plans to launch many more in the coming years.
How Starlink Works
Starlink uses a constellation of low-Earth orbit (LEO) satellites, which are designed to provide high-speed internet access to users on the ground. The satellites are equipped with advanced technology, including Hall effect thrusters, which allow them to maneuver and maintain their position in orbit. The satellites also have a high-gain antenna, which enables them to communicate with user terminals on the ground.
The user terminals, also known as dish antennas, are used to connect to the Starlink satellites. These terminals are designed to be compact and easy to use, making it simple for users to set up and access the internet. The terminals use advanced software to track the satellites and maintain a stable connection, ensuring a high-quality internet experience.
Features and Benefits of Starlink
Starlink offers a range of features and benefits that make it an attractive option for users. Some of the key advantages include:
High-speed internet: Starlink provides fast internet speeds, with download speeds of up to 1 Gbps and latency as low as 20 ms.
Global coverage: Starlink aims to provide internet access to the entire world, including remote and underserved areas.
Low latency: The use of LEO satellites and advanced technology enables Starlink to provide low-latency internet access, making it suitable for real-time applications such as video streaming and online gaming.
Affordability: Starlink is designed to be an affordable option for users, with prices starting at $99 per month for the residential plan.
Impact and Future of Starlink
Starlink has the potential to revolutionize the way we access and use the internet. By providing high-speed, low-latency internet access to remote and underserved areas, Starlink can help bridge the digital divide and promote economic development. The project also has the potential to disrupt the traditional telecommunications industry, providing a new and innovative option for users.
However, there are also challenges and concerns related to Starlink, such as the potential for satellite congestion and the impact on the environment. As the project continues to develop and expand, it will be important to address these concerns and ensure that Starlink is used in a responsible and sustainable way.
